When memmax is forced using "-m", the per-process memory limit is enforced using setrlimit(), but this value is not used to compute the automatic maxconn limit. In addition, the per-process memory limit didn't consider the fact that the shared SSL cache only needs to be accounted once. The doc was also fixed to clearly state that "-m" is global and not per process. It makes sense because people who use -m want to protect the system's resources regardless of whatever appears in the configuration. |
